Latest Patents

Kubo's latest patents include a photoelectric conversion device, a process cartridge, and an image forming apparatus. The photoelectric conversion device features a support structure that incorporates a charge-transporting layer made from either an organic charge-transporting material or a sensitizing dye electrode layer. This layer is strategically placed on the support, complemented by a ceramic film that enhances its performance. Additionally, his patent for a photoconductor outlines a design that includes a cylindrical conductive support, a water-repellent resin film, and a coating film, all engineered to improve the efficiency of image formation.
